High-End Ceramic Japanese Teapots

Sakuraco's Japanese Drinkware Collection is Chic and Functional

The specialty retailer Sakuraco offers a high-end ceramic teapot from its Japanese Drinkware collection — the Sakura Tokoname Ware Teapot. This item is handcrafted by Yutaka Tsuzuki of Daikōji Kiln, a certified Traditional Craft Artisan, in Tokoname City, the site of one of Japan’s Rokkoyō (Six Ancient Kilns).

The Sakura Tokoname Ware Teapot is distinguished by its cherry blossom motif, which was created through a stamped patterning technique. The Japanese drinkware piece includes a specialized interior filter for tea leaves and a glazed finish designed for both visual appeal and tactile warmth. Its capacity is 200 ml.

Sakuraco notes that the highly authentic Sakura Tokoname Ware Teapot has limited availability. The object is effectively positioned as an artifact that embodies functional beauty and deep cultural heritage within the ritual of tea preparation.
